Original Description
Richard Parkes Bonington’s Beached Boats On The Seine Near Quillebeuf, France captures the serene yet evocative beauty of a riverside scene with masterful delicacy. Painted around 1825–26, this watercolor embodies Bonington’s signature blend of Romanticism and early Impressionist spontaneity, showcasing his extraordinary ability to render light and atmosphere. The composition features weathered boats resting on the Seine’s banks, their reflections shimmering in the tranquil water, while softly rendered skies and distant landscapes evoke a sense of timeless tranquility. Bonington, though his career was tragically short, played a pivotal role in bridging English and French Romantic landscapes, influencing artists like Delacroix and later Impressionists. This work exemplifies his technical brilliance—loose yet precise brushwork, a subdued yet luminous palette—and remains celebrated for its poetic immediacy and historical significance in 19th-century European art.
